About the Role

As a Project Engineer, you'll play a key role in driving innovation, operational excellence, and business continuity across the plant. You'll lead impactful projects from concept through implementation while partnering with multi-functional teams to deliver measurable results.

Responsibilities

  • Lead multi-functional project teams to implement strategic plant initiatives, achieve cost savings targets, and support business continuity.
  • Develop project plans, business justifications, technical specifications, and budgets.
  • Prepare and submit capital expenditure requests.
  • Manage a diverse portfolio of projects including product design changes, sustainability initiatives, process improvements, and equipment implementation.
  • Identify, develop, and implement continuous improvement opportunities that enhance performance and efficiency.
  • Generate and champion new project ideas that bring value for the business.
  • Collaborate with vendors on equipment design, specifications, concepts, and contract negotiations.
  • Oversee equipment purchases, installations, and the development of new manufacturing processes and machinery.
  • Provide creative leadership in solving complex operational and technical challenges.
  • Independently identify solutions, secure resources, and drive projects to successful completion.
  • Research, evaluate, and implement new technologies to improve manufacturing operations.
  • Develop and implement test methods, process validations, and measurement system analyses.
  • Support additional business initiatives and projects as needed.

Requirements

  • Bachelor's degree in Engineering, Industrial Management, Science, or a related field required.
  • Minimum of 3 years leading continuous improvement projects within a manufacturing environment.

Skills

  • Strong verbal and written communication skills.
  • Proven ability to collaborate and build effective teams.
  • Self-motivated with strong independent decision-making abilities.
  • Experience with machine design and manufacturing equipment.
  • Advanced troubleshooting and problem-solving skills.
  • Knowledge of safety and ergonomic principles.
  • Project management experience.
  • Understanding of quality systems and manufacturing procedures.
  • Basic knowledge of logistics, planning, and financial concepts.
  • Proficiency with Microsoft Office and standard business software.
